Description
Pteronia incana, commonly known as gray pteronia, belongs to the Asteraceae family. In an agricultural context, it is regarded as a resilient perennial shrub that thrives in arid climates. Its distinct gray appearance is due to a dense layer of trichomes, which are microscopic hairs that help the plant minimize water loss through transpiration under intense sun exposure.
The native distribution of Pteronia incana is primarily located in the semi-arid regions of South Africa, notably the Karoo biome. This plant is a typical inhabitant of harsh, rocky terrain where it has evolved to survive with very little annual rainfall. It plays a critical role in stabilizing soil and maintaining the ecological balance in its native habitat.
Botanically, the plant features branched, woody stems and narrow leaves designed for survival in water-scarce environments. It produces small, yellow flower heads characteristic of the Asteraceae family. Its root system is exceptionally deep and extensive, allowing it to tap into subterranean water reserves that remain inaccessible to more shallow-rooted species.
Regarding its agricultural requirements, Pteronia incana does not require intensive human intervention or standard field cultivation techniques. It is highly drought-tolerant and thrives in well-drained, nutrient-poor soils. Farmers typically manage it as part of rangelands, ensuring that stocking rates of livestock do not lead to overgrazing, which could deplete the plant's recovery capacity.
The primary agricultural utility of this plant is as a source of browse for small livestock such as sheep and goats. While it provides fodder during lean seasons, it is not considered a high-performance crop but rather a crucial stabilizer for arid range productivity. Diseases and pests include specific leaf-feeding insects and occasional fungal pathogens that may occur during unusually wet, humid weather conditions.
